A polite greeting with 'Namaskaaram' or a simple 'Hello' goes a long way. Use a light nod or hands joined in prayer position.
Dress modestly; remove shoes where required; avoid pointing feet toward deities or religious icons; ask before taking photos inside sacred spaces.
Offerings and sharing food are common; accept hospitality graciously. When in doubt, follow local hosts’ lead and observe how others queue and interact.

Tipping in Obalāpuram
Ensure a smooth experience
In upscale restaurants, leave 5-10% if service is good. In casual eateries and street food stalls, rounding up or a small tip is common but not mandatory.
Cash is widely accepted, with growing use of digital payments. UPI, mobile wallets, and cards are commonly accepted in hotels, larger eateries, and tourist-focused shops.
Best Time to Visit
And what to expect in different seasons...
Mar through May brings hot, humid days with temperatures that can climb into the 90s °F (30s–40s °C). Stay hydrated, wear light clothing, and plan outdoor activities for early mornings or late afternoons.
June through September sees frequent rain showers; lush greenery follows, but carry a rain jacket and waterproof footwear. Some streets may flood during heavy downpours.
October through February offers cooler, pleasant days with mild evenings; it’s ideal for walking tours and outdoor photography.
